fix: draft kegiatan hanya terlihat oleh kreator dan super_admin, hanya ketua yang bisa approve, hilangkan field status dari form, default status draft

This commit is contained in:
2026-04-04 07:35:52 +07:00
parent fcd3816825
commit 5e70336774
4 changed files with 24 additions and 11 deletions
@@ -19,15 +19,6 @@ class ActivityForm
Textarea::make('description')->label('Deskripsi')->rows(3)->columnSpanFull(),
DatePicker::make('start_date')->label('Mulai')->required(),
DatePicker::make('end_date')->label('Selesai')->required(),
Select::make('status')
->options([
'draft' => 'Draft',
'pending' => 'Pending',
'approved' => 'Disetujui',
'rejected' => 'Ditolak',
])
->default('draft')
->required(),
Select::make('participants')
->label('Peserta')
->relationship('participants', 'name')